While filling JEE form it says to put fathers name according to 10th marksheet, but in my 10th marksheet only mothers name is given

Hello,

If your 10th marksheet does not have your father’s name, then you don’t need to enter it from there.

Here is what you should do:

  • Use your father’s name as it appears in other official documents like Aadhaar, birth certificate, or school records (class 11/12).

  • The rule simply means: do not change the spelling or format of names that are already printed in official documents .

  • If the father’s name is not printed in the 10th marksheet, it is not a problem . Many boards only print the mother’s name.

You can safely enter your father’s name as per your other valid documents.
